Jefferson County Sheriff?s Office reports two deer-vehicle accidents.
Pablo Antonio Garrido of 1702 Rukmapura Park, No. 16, was driving a 2012 Toyota Prius south on Jasmine Avenue when he struck a deer in the roadway at 8:38 p.m., causing an estimated $1,500 damage to the car.
Miguel Piedra of Columbus Junction was driving a 1997 Toyota 4-Runner south on Pleasant Plain Road when he struck a deer in the roadway at 4:28 a.m. today. The collision caused disabling damage to the vehicle?s front grill, bumper, radiator and passenger front quarter panel.
